> This is to announce the release of Ferret v6.82, and PyFerret 0.0.9.  This version of PyFerret incorporates the double-precision and 6-dimensional enhancements that were part of the Ferret v6.8 release.
> 
> There is one bug fix to Ferret v6.8.2: previous 6-D Ferret had trouble correctly initializing the grids for some NetCDF or OPeNDAP datasets.  The release includes several new Ferret scripts as well.
